Why Children's Dental Health Matters
Children's oral health is often overlooked, but the statistics tell a sobering story. According to the American Dental Association, tooth decay is the most common chronic disease among children in the United States. Because of that, left untreated, cavities can lead to pain, infection, difficulty eating, and problems with speech development. In some cases, poor oral health in childhood can even affect a child's academic performance and self-esteem.

Fluoride Treatments and Sealants
Fluoride treatments and dental sealants are two of the most effective tools in preventive dentistry. Sealants, on the other hand, act as a protective barrier over the chewing surfaces of back teeth, where cavities are most likely to form. Fluoride strengthens tooth enamel, making it more resistant to acid attacks from bacteria in the mouth. The Science Behind Preventive Dentistry
Preventive dentistry is backed by decades of scientific research. Plus, studies have shown that for every dollar spent on prevention, up to $50 can be saved in restorative treatments. This is not just good economics—it is good medicine.
When children receive regular dental cleanings and exams, professionals can identify early signs of decay, gum disease, or developmental issues. Early detection means simpler, less invasive treatments and better outcomes. Fluoride and sealants have been proven in countless studies to reduce the incidence of cavities by up to 80 percent in children Worth knowing..
On top of that, the psychological benefits of preventive care cannot be overstated. Children who grow up with positive dental experiences are far more likely to maintain regular dental visits as adults. They are less likely to suffer from dental anxiety, which affects millions of people worldwide and often leads to years of neglected oral health It's one of those things that adds up. What age should my child start seeing a dentist?
The American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ry recommends that children visit the dentist by their first birthday or within six months of their first tooth appearing It's one of those things that adds up..

Are fluoride treatments safe for children?
Yes. So fluoride treatments are safe when applied by trained professionals in the recommended doses. They are one of the most effective ways to prevent tooth decay in children It's one of those things that adds up..
